The treatment can hurt, with a sharp prickling, snapping, or stinging sensation.“Typically, I treat patients with dark skin tones with topical treatments and a series of chemical peels, before laser or IPL devices.” Treating tanned skin, even from self-tanning lotion, can cause burns, which can cause permanent hypo- or hyperpigmentaton. Christopher Weyer, a Tucson, Arizona, dermatologist. “IPL for African American skin can be challenging,” says Dr. Because the melanin (pigment) in skin absorbs light energy, deep skin tones are more likely to burn and, potentially, scar. It works best on fair to medium skin tones, Fitzpatrick skin types I–III.The risks of IPL are lower than those of some other light-based procedures. ![]() You usually can return to your routine immediately after your treatment. IPL treatments bypasses the skin's surface, so recovery time is minimal.However, multiple sessions are usually required for the best results. This skin treatment is often less expensive than laser treatments that address the same concerns.In one study, nearly 60% of patients experienced at least moderate improvement in skin around the eyes after three monthly IPL sessions. It can also improve skin texture, including fine lines and wrinkles.IPL can also be helpful at reducing discoloration from acne and acne scars.The treatment is also effective at reducing redness caused by broken capillaries, rosacea, and general facial flushing-something only a few other light-based modalities can do.Lorrie Klein, a dermatologic surgeon in Laguna Niguel, California. IPL photofacials are best used to treat excess or uneven pigmentation, helping to reduce age spots, sunspots, freckles, and melasma (aka hyperpigmentation), according to Dr.They’re typically performed three to four weeks apart. Most people need a series of IPL photofacial treatments to see optimal results. The size of the head of the IPL device is usually larger than most laser spot sizes, which allows for rapid treatment of large body areas. This light treatment can be performed on the face, hands, neck, chest, and legs.
